Hi all,

If I refer to @zaccharles google sheet, we have been averaging circ. 234 new users per day in the last month and a half with a flat-ish trend. The latest mark 5 days ago means we need to average 452 new users per day until the end of the year to achieve the 100k objective.

Am I the only one thinking we will not hit the target?

I appreciate it may be due to team constraints, but monthly just isn’t that often. Hopefully as you grow your team you can look to increase the frequency of educational content. Not necessarily through a weekend read but through regular posts. I think measuring the acquisition and retention based on this content is the wrong approach. It’s core to your mission and what helps you differentiate from the likes of Revolut. It engages the community and that is your most powerful asset. Although we are in a different era I highly doubt Michelin would have binned off the Michelin guide after 6 months due to poor ā€œacquisition and retentionā€. The time frame is just too short. Educating people on investing will have probably one of the longest ā€œsales cyclesā€ ever. As for someone who has never invested before it’s a big jump from nothing to putting their money in a ā€stockā€. Using data is good, but I believe there are times when you need to trust your vision.
